About Jean‐Jacques Bénet
Jean‐Jacques Bénet is a scholar working on Equine, Small Animals and Endocrinology, having authored 11 papers that have together received 412 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Veterinary Medicine and Surgery (3 papers), Human-Animal Interaction Studies (3 papers) and Animal Disease Management and Epidemiology (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Equine (77 citations), Small Animals (253 citations) and Endocrinology (65 citations). Jean‐Jacques Bénet has collaborated with scholars based in France and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Bernard‐Marie Paragon, G. Blanchard, Anne Le Flèche‐Matéos, Antoine Dürrbach, Patrice Nordmann, Xavier Monnet, Patrick A. D. Grimont, Marie-Frédérique Lartigue, Bruno Garin‐Bastuji and Sandy Faye.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, Journal of Clinical Microbiology and Journal of Nutrition.
